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an is a classical
martial art with roots dating back many
centuries. Developed by Grandmaster Hwang
Kee.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an is a composite
of both a hard and soft techniques. Its
hardness comes from its powerful and
effective kicking techniques (a trademark of
the Moo Duk Kwan style) and Japanese
influenced blocking, while its soft and
flowing techniques come from Chinese Martial
Arts influence .
The founder of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an,
Grandmaster Hwang Kee (1914 - 2002), was
considered to be a martial arts prodigy and
master by his peers at the age of 22. In
1936 his job with the Korean railroad
allowed him to travel to China where he
studied under Master Yang, Kuk Jin until
1946. Throughout his life he studied and
researched every martial arts resource
available to him and combined eastern
philosophies to create what is today Soo
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an.
Soo Bahk Do translated means, "the
way of the striking fist". It is our
physical technique, and art, which is a
combination of
Grandmaster Hwang Kee's studies and
experiences in the martial arts. Soo Bahk Do
provides the practitioner with the physical
techniques which allows them to develop both
an effective form of self defense as well as
a means to develop a strong and healthy
body.

Moo Duk Kwan is our Moo Do philosophy and
translated means, "School to teach
Martial and Virtue through training in the
martial arts", or roughly, "School
of martial virtue". The study of the
Moo Duk Kwan style promotes a healthy and
disciplined mind, strong personal character,
and respect for life and nature. It is this
development that helps one achieve a mature
attitude, as well as give you the mental
strength to find your full potential.
Together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an creates a balance, or Um Yang (similar meaning to the Chinese Yin Yang). Moo Duk Kwan ideals and philosophy develops the mind and spirit, while Soo Bahk Do technique and art develops a strong and healthy body and means of defense. This balance is needed to produce harmony. The Moo Duk Kwan philosophy gives us the maturity and ethics to properly use the techniques of Soo Bahk Do responsibly. The physical benefits that Soo Bahk Do provides allows us to enjoy the benefits of a matured and peaceful character (confidence, courage, discipline, calmness...). Together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an work to develop every aspect of a person in order to create a person who can face the world, it's conflicts, and society in an intelligent, and virtuous manner.
To help promote a standardization of growth and the teachings of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an, it was decided to establish the U.S.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an Federation. This federation is a non-profit organization which is devoted to the maintenance and growth of Soo Bahk Do Moo Duk Kwan as Grandmaster Hwang Kee had intended.
